Rahori Population - Jaipur, Rajasthan

Rahori is a large village located in Jamwa Ramgarh Tehsil of Jaipur district, Rajasthan with total 338 families residing. The Rahori village has population of 2023 of which 1034 are males while 989 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Rahori village population of children with age 0-6 is 341 which makes up 16.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Rahori village is 956 which is higher than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Rahori as per census is 905, higher than Rajasthan average of 888.

Rahori village has lower liter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Rahori village was 62.43 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Rahori Male literacy stands at 80.12 % while female literacy rate was 44.14 %.

Caste Factor

In Rahori village, most of the village population is from Schedule Tribe (ST).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 41.42 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 7.02 % of total population in Rahori village.

Work Profile

In Rahori village out of total population, 811 were engaged in work activities. 84.71 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 15.29 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 811 workers engaged in Main Work, 339 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 4 were Agricultural labourer.
